After NiP won the Intel Extreme Masters Fall 2021 Europe, the editors of the HLTV portal recognized Nikolai 'device' Ridtz's contribution to the victory in this championship and awarded the cybersportsman with the nineteenth MVP medal.

In the IEM Fall 2021 Europe finals, NiP defeated ENCE with a score of 3-1. The team prevailed on Overpass, then lost on Mirage, and then the team took Ancient and Nuke.

Danish sniper Nikolai 'device' Ridtz finished the championship with a record of 1.35. He is taller than Mathieu 'ZywOo' Erbot, who plays under the Team Vitality tag. For the Swede, this MVP is the first after joining the ranks of NiP. At the moment, Nikolai Ridts has no equal in terms of the number of MVPs received. His closest and concurrently main opponent is Ukrainian Natus Vincere star Alexander 's1mple' Kostylev. The latter currently has 16 won MVPs. In addition, Alexander 's1mple' Kostylev became the first CS: GO player in the world to win an MVP medal even when he was defeated in the championship.

For their victory, NiP received a reward of $ 27,500 + 2,500 RMR + 500 ESL Pro Tour. The runners-up ENCE earned $ 17,500 + 2,344 RMR + 350 ESL Pro Tour in their work. Intel Extreme Masters Fall 2021 Europe was the only RMR event to be held offline. The teams visited Stockholm to split $ 105,000 among each other.
